1. 前言上一篇文章,介绍了使用 Java + Spring Boot + MyBatis 构建 RESTful API 的详细步骤;很多小伙伴表示,更愿意用 Python 编写 RESTful API 服务,希望我能写一下本篇将以 Python 开始介绍搭建 RESTful API 的流程 ,使用的技术栈是:Flask + flask-restful + flasgger2. 安装依赖使用
## RESTful API实例详解 ### 1. 简介 RESTful API是一种基于REST架构风格设计的API,它使用HTTP协议进行通信,是目前常用的API设计风格之一。在本文中,我们将以一个简单的示例来介绍如何实现一个RESTful API。 ### 2. 整体流程 为了更好地理解整个过程,我们可以将RESTful API实例的实现流程总结为以下几个步骤: | 步骤 | 描述
原创 2024-05-30 10:32:56
91阅读
Restful API接口规范实例 作为一名经验丰富的开发者,我将向你介绍如何实现Restful API接口规范的示例。在这个示例中,我们将使用Node.js和Express框架来创建一个简单的Restful API接口,并确保它符合Restful API的最佳实践。 整个流程可以分为以下步骤: | 步骤 | 描述 | |:----:|:-------------
原创 2024-05-06 11:30:32
188阅读
 1、安装FlaskFlask 是一个 Python 实现的 Web 开发微框架。在安装好Python的机器上,命令行上输入$ sudo pip install Flask 即可完成安装2、简单示例from flask import Flask app = Flask(__name__) @app.route('/') def hello_world(): retur
转载 2023-05-31 12:45:45
304阅读
1.Restful风格接口简介: 答:Restful这个词,是一个外国人Roy Thomas Fielding在2000年提出的。这个Fielding将他对互联网软件的架构原则,定名为REST,即Representational State Transfer的缩写。这个词组翻译为就是“表现层状态转换”。表现层指定就是资源,如果一个架构符合REST原则,则称它为RESTful架构。这只是一种软件架构
如何使用Python实现RESTful API 作为一名经验丰富的开发者,很高兴能够教会你如何使用Python实现RESTful APIRESTful API 是一种设计风格,用于创建具有灵活性和可扩展性的 API。下面我将为你介绍构建Python RESTful API 的整个流程,以及每个步骤所需的代码示例。 流程梳理: 步骤 | 操作
原创 2024-04-24 12:21:03
67阅读
python 全栈开发,Day95(RESTful API介绍,基于Django实现RESTful API,DRF 序列化)  昨日内容回顾 1. rest framework serializer(序列化)的简单使用 QuerySet([ obj, obj, obj]) --> JSON格式数据 0. 安装和导入:
转载 3月前
444阅读
RESTFUL API学习教程构建RESTful Web服务,像其他编程技能一样,一部分是艺术,一部分是科学。随着互联网行业的发展,创造一个REST API变得更加具体与新兴的最佳实践。由于REST Web服务不遵循除了HTTP规定的标准,它建立在符合行业最佳实践的REST风格的API来简化开发,提高客户利用率是非常重要的。目前,没有很多REST API的指南,帮助孤独的开发者RestApiTut
转载 2023-12-06 23:22:47
138阅读
Python语言,用GET方法从Restful API获取信息和用POST方法向Restful API发生数据 使用PythonRestful API本文给出用GET方法从Restful API获取信息和用POST方法向Restful API发生消息。主要使用的包是urllib和json,其中urllib用来发送http请求,json包用来解析和构造j
转载 2023-05-29 15:36:16
409阅读
Response.php :包含一个Request类,即输出类。根据接收到的Content-Type,将Request类返回的数组拼接成对应的格式,加上header后输出. <?php class Response { const HTTP_VERSION = "HTTP/1.1"; //返回结果 public static function sendResponse($data) { //获取数据 if ($data) { $code = 200; $message = 'OK'; } else { $code = 404; $data = array('error' => 'Not Found'); $message = 'Not Found';
原创 2023-09-04 09:51:32
140阅读
# Python Restful API 框架详解 作为一名经验丰富的开发者,我将教会你如何实现一个Python Restful API框架。Restful API是一种采用REST架构风格的API,可以实现前后端的数据交互。在Python中,我们可以使用一些框架来快速搭建Restful API。下面我将介绍整个过程的流程,并结合代码示例进行详细讲解。 ## 整个过程的流程 | 步骤 | 操
原创 2024-04-24 12:20:11
123阅读
在现代的软件开发中,使用Python编写RESTful API已经成为一种流行的趋势。Python的轻量级框架Flask为开发者提供了一个简单而有效的工具来构建RESTful API。在本篇文章中,我将向你介绍如何使用Python Flask框架来编写RESTful API。 ### Python Flask RESTful API实现步骤: | 步骤 | 操作
原创 2024-04-24 12:19:51
104阅读
# Python Restful API 开发指南 作为一名经验丰富的开发者,我将为你详细介绍如何使用Python开发Restful APIRestful API是一种通过HTTP协议对资源进行增删改查的API设计风格,它是现代Web开发中常用的一种方式。 ## 流程概述 下面是Python Restful API开发的整体流程: | 步骤 | 描述 | | ------ | ------
原创 2024-04-23 17:42:18
42阅读
# 如何实现 Python Restful API 接口 作为一名经验丰富的开发者,你需要教导一位刚入行的小白如何实现 Python Restful API 接口。下面是整个过程的流程图和步骤表格: ```mermaid erDiagram API --> |发送请求| Server Server --> |响应数据| API ``` | 步骤 | 操作 | | ---- |
原创 2024-03-12 06:14:16
42阅读
# Python Restful API 框架 ## 介绍 随着互联网的发展,越来越多的应用程序需要提供API接口来与其他应用程序进行通信。Restful API是一种设计风格,它使用HTTP协议来进行通信,通过URL和请求方式来表示资源和操作。 Python是一种非常流行的编程语言,拥有丰富的库和框架支持,如Django、Flask等。本文将介绍如何使用Python来构建一个Restful
原创 2023-09-27 21:35:43
52阅读
# WSGIServer和RESTful API的使用与实现 ## 1. 什么是WSGIServer? WSGIServer是Python的一个库,用于创建和运行WSGI(Web Server Gateway Interface)应用程序。WSGI是一种Web服务器和Web应用程序之间的通信协议,它定义了一种标准的接口,允许Web服务器和Web应用程序之间进行交互和通信。 WSGIServe
原创 2023-08-02 08:18:51
187阅读
网络应用程序,分为前端和后端两个部分。当前的发展趋势,就是前端设备层出不穷(手机、平板、桌面电脑、其他专用设备......)。因此,必须有一种统一的机制,方便不同的前端设备与后端进行通信。这导致API构架的流行,甚至出现"API First"的设计思想。RESTful API是目前比较成熟的一套互联网应用程序的API设计理论。我以前写过一篇《理解RESTful架构》,探讨如何理解这个概念。
转载 2024-05-22 12:05:03
76阅读
文章目录基础api设计基本思路举例:(axios)新增一个title为“abc”的item删除id为5的item把id为5的item的title修改为"bbb"把id为5的item修改{title:"bbb",content:"xxx"}获取id小于10000中前100个item(字段需要自己设置)登录、登出,注册,注销HTTP报头(暂略)HTTP状态码(部分) 基础1.最好要带有版本(设置在u
转载 2024-03-15 15:26:13
79阅读
接口: API(Application Programming Interface,应用程序接口)是一些预先定义的接口(如函数、HTTP接口),或指软件系统不同组成部分衔接的约定。 用来提供应用程序与开发人员基于某软件或硬件得以访问的一组例程,而又无需访问源码,或理解内部工作机制的细节。接口(API): 可以指访问servlet, controller的url, 调用其他程序的 函数架构风格: a
转载 2024-04-30 19:03:16
44阅读
前言  对于前后端分离的项目,主要是以API为界限进行解耦,那么在web开发中,对于api的设计能够遵循REST设计原则,即可以称为Restful api。使用Restful设计api主要有两点好处,一是表现力更强,更易于理解;二是Restful为无状态的,不管前端是何种设备何种状态都能够无差别的请求资源。构建步骤一:基于业务领域的数据建模,而不是基于功能建模 基于功能建模时,会造成api臃肿并且
转载 2024-03-18 22:14:03
67阅读
  • 1
  • 2
  • 3
  • 4
  • 5